How to Build a Blockchain App: a Comprehensive Tech and Business Guide

Date:

Share:

Blockchain technology has taken the world by storm, revolutionizing various industries, from finance to healthcare and supply chain management. Entrepreneurs and developers are increasingly interested in harnessing the potential of blockchain to create innovative applications. In this comprehensive guide, we will walk you through the process of building a blockchain app, covering both the technical and business aspects.

Table of Contents:

Understanding Blockchain Technology

1.1 What is Blockchain?

1.2 Types of Blockchains

1.3 Key Features of Blockchain

Identifying Your App’s Purpose and Use Case

2.1 Defining the Problem

2.2 Identifying the Target Audience

2.3 Determining the Use Case

Choosing the Right Blockchain Platform

3.1 Public vs. Private Blockchains

3.2 Popular Blockchain Platforms

3.3 Smart Contracts

Development Tools and Languages

4.1 Solidity

4.2 Ethereum Development Tools

4.3 Other Blockchain Development Languages

Designing the User Interface (UI)

5.1 User-Friendly Design

5.2 Security Considerations

5.3 Wallet Integration

  1. Understanding Blockchain Technology

1.1 What is Blockchain?

Blockchain is a decentralized, distributed ledger technology that records transactions across multiple computers in a tamper-resistant manner. It consists of blocks of data linked together in a chronological chain, with each block containing a batch of transactions.

1.2 Types of Blockchains

There are two main types of blockchains: public and private. Public blockchains are open to anyone, while private blockchains restrict access to authorized participants.

1.3 Key Features of Blockchain

Transparency and immutability

Decentralization

Security through cryptography

Smart contracts for automated actions

  1. Identifying Your App’s Purpose and Use Case

2.1 Defining the Problem

Start by identifying a real-world problem that blockchain can solve. For example, supply chain tracking, identity verification, or decentralized finance (DeFi) applications.

2.2 Identifying the Target Audience

Determine who will benefit from your app. Understanding your target audience helps in designing a user-friendly interface and marketing effectively.

2.3 Determining the Use Case

Define the specific use case for your blockchain app. Will it involve payments, voting, or asset management? Be clear about the purpose.

  1. Choosing the Right Blockchain Platform

3.1 Public vs. Private Blockchains

Decide whether a public or private blockchain is suitable for your project. Public blockchains like Ethereum offer more transparency, while private blockchains provide control.

3.2 Popular Blockchain Platforms

Consider Ethereum, Binance Smart Chain, or other platforms based on your project’s needs.

3.3 Smart Contracts

Understand how smart contracts can automate processes within your app.

  1. Development Tools and Languages

4.1 Solidity

Learn Solidity, a popular language for writing smart contracts on Ethereum.

4.2 Ethereum Development Tools

Use tools like Truffle, Remix, and Hardhat for easier development.

4.3 Other Blockchain Development Languages

Explore alternatives like Rust (for Polkadot) or Chaincode (for Hyperledger Fabric).

  1. Designing the User Interface (UI)

5.1 User-Friendly Design

Create an intuitive UI that simplifies user interactions with the blockchain.

5.2 Security Considerations

Prioritize security in your design to protect user assets.

5.3 Wallet Integration

Integrate cryptocurrency wallets for easy transactions.

Conclusion

In the ever-evolving blockchain landscape, staying informed about new developments and technologies is crucial. Building a blockchain app is a journey that requires dedication, learning, and adaptability. With the right combination of technical expertise and business acumen, you can create a blockchain app that not only addresses real-world problems but also contributes to the growth of the blockchain ecosystem.

adminhttps://insprationbuzz.com
Hi I am SEO Outreach Specialist, Buy Guest Posts from DA50+ unique websites. Email Olafharek3@gmail.com

━ more like this

Top Five Indicators for Successful Forex Trading in Dubai

Introduction Forex trading has become increasingly popular in Dubai, attracting traders from various backgrounds seeking financial opportunities. However, the forex market's dynamic nature demands a...

Teltlk: Revolutionizing Communication in the Digital Age

In today's fast-paced world,Teltlk communication plays a pivotal role in connecting people across the globe. The evolution of technology has transformed the way we...

Bitfinex Referral Code: A Guide to Earning Rewards

Introduction Bitfinex Referral Code In the world of cryptocurrency trading, Bitfinex has established itself as a leading platform offering a wide range of features and...

Coineal Login: A Step-by-Step Guide

Are you interested in Coineal Login  exploring the world of cryptocurrencies and trading digital assets? If so, Coineal is a popular cryptocurrency exchange platform...

Altcointrader.co.za Upload Documents: A Step-by-Step Guide

Are you a user of Altcointrader.co.za Upload Documents, a popular cryptocurrency exchange platform? If so, you may have encountered a situation where you need...